Re: unhelpful error message

Поиск
Список
Период
Сортировка
От Tom Lane
Тема Re: unhelpful error message
Дата
Msg-id 6912.1245333801@sss.pgh.pa.us
обсуждение исходный текст
Ответ на unhelpful error message  (hubert depesz lubaczewski <depesz@depesz.com>)
Ответы Re: unhelpful error message  (hubert depesz lubaczewski <depesz@depesz.com>)
Re: unhelpful error message  ("Kevin Grittner" <Kevin.Grittner@wicourts.gov>)
Список pgsql-bugs
hubert depesz lubaczewski <depesz@depesz.com> writes:
> # create table sold_products (items int4, product_id int4);
> # create table products (id int4, codename text);
> # select sp.count, p.codename from sold_products sp join products p on sp.product_id = p.id;

> shown error:
> ERROR:  column "p.codename" must appear in the GROUP BY clause or be used in an aggregate function
> LINE 1: select sp.count, p.codename from sold_products sp join produ...
>                          ^

Per the fine manual, sp.count is another way of writing count(sp).
Does it make more sense now?

            regards, tom lane

В списке pgsql-bugs по дате отправления:

Предыдущее
От: hubert depesz lubaczewski
Дата:
Сообщение: unhelpful error message
Следующее
От: hubert depesz lubaczewski
Дата:
Сообщение: Re: unhelpful error message